Output e86c639b8e8fca571fdf62917eb938b22f6faa656a9df2fe21008376ba96a855:0

value
46862916
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b94b241c0c786a019979d09693f331c4cf9c961 OP_EQUAL
address
MLdCHhJoaZdkuUQMuSsNp3tCUhqT5d2cbH
transaction
e86c639b8e8fca571fdf62917eb938b22f6faa656a9df2fe21008376ba96a855
spent
true